JUDAEA, Neapolis. Elagabalus. AD 218-222. Æ (21mm, 10.50 g, 7h). Laureate, draped, and cuirassed bust right, seen from behind; c/m: A within rectangular incuse / Quadriga facing carrying the stone of Emesa decorated with eagle on left and Mount Gerizim on right. Rosenberger 49; Sofaer 102 var. (bust); for c/m: Howgego 666. Brown surfaces, cleaning scratches. Good Fine.

From the Dr. Jay M. Galst Collection. Ex Edward Janis Collection (Coin Galleries, 14 April 1999).
